A preparation method for anthraquinone-type PU modified MBBR filler and the anthraquinone-type PU modified MBBR filler

The present invention provides a preparation method for anthraquinone-type PU modified MBBR filler and the anthraquinone-type PU modified MBBR filler itself, pertaining to the field of MBBR filler technology. The method involves adding 100 parts by weight of polyolefin, 3-30 parts by weight of anthraquinone-type polyurethane, 0.5-2 parts by weight of peroxide initiator, and 0.1-5 parts by weight of optional additives to a twin-screw extruder for melting, extrusion, granulation, and then injection molding to obtain the final product. The anthraquinone-type polyurethane contains at least one first segment formed from diaminoanthraquinone and at least one second segment formed from at least one of polyether diol, polyester diol, and alkyl diol; the end group of the anthraquinone-type polyurethane is a carbon-carbon unsaturated double bond. The anthraquinone-type PU modified MBBR filler prepared according to the present invention features a carbon-carbon double bond capped polyurethane in its substrate, which undergoes polymerization and grafting reactions onto the polyolefin under the initiation of peroxide, exhibiting excellent impact resistance, wear resistance, and good water treatment efficiency.
